3Pillar Global is seeking an iOS Senior Software Engineer to join their team. The ideal candidate will design and build advanced applications for the iOS platform, collaborating with cross-functional teams to define, design, and ship new features. Key responsibilities include working on bug fixing, improving application performance, and continuously discovering, evaluating, and implementing new technologies to maximize development efficiency.
The role requires proficiency in Swift and Objective-C, strong knowledge of iOS SDK and frameworks, and experience with RESTful APIs. The candidate should be skilled in version control systems, particularly Git, and have a strong understanding of Apple's design principles and interface guidelines. Problem-solving skills, experience with automated testing and debugging tools, and the ability to optimize applications for performance are essential.
Preferred skills include experience with SwiftUI, knowledge of data storage solutions like Core Data and SQLite, understanding of mobile security protocols, and familiarity with cloud services and third-party libraries. Experience with continuous integration and deployment tools, Agile methodologies, and cross-platform development frameworks is a plus.
3Pillar Global offers a culture driven by the power of teamwork and open collaboration. They focus on building breakthrough software solutions that power digital businesses. The company has been recognized on the Inc. 5000 list ten years in a row and has won the Washington Post Top Workplaces Award three times. Their key differentiator is the Product Mindset, which focuses on building for outcomes and aligning with client goals from the earliest stages through launch and beyond.
Join 3Pillar Global to be part of a team committed to continuous improvement and making an outsized impact in the software development industry.